What does floating dock mean?

Definitions for floating dock
float·ing dock

This dictionary definitions page includes all the possible meanings, example usage and translations of the word floating dock.

Princeton's WordNet

  1. floating dock, floating dry docknoun

    dry dock that can be submerged under a vessel and then raised

Wikidata

  1. Floating dock

    A floating dock is a platform or ramp supported by pontoons. It is usually joined to the shore with a gangway. The pier is usually held in place by vertical poles referred to as pilings, which are embedded in the seafloor or by anchored cables. Frequently used in marinas, this type of pier maintains a fixed vertical relationship to watercraft secured to it, independent of tidal, river or lake elevation. In some regions of the world, a floating dock is called a pontoon.
